Pork carnitas is a dish that will make your mouth water, so simple to make and so delicious.
Serves 4
Instructions
For the carnitas
- 5 Pork shoulder steaks
- Fresh oregano
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p black ground pepper
- 2 tbsp rapeseed oil
- 1/2 water
To serve
- Corn tortillas
- Chopped fresh coriander
- Chopped white onion
- Slices of just ripe avocado
- Tomatillo Green salsa
Method
- Preheat the oven to 180 degrees. Heat the oil in a casserole dish (Dutch oven), once hot, sear the pork steaks in both sides, then once seared add the fresh oregano, salt, Â pepper & water. Put the lid and place the casserole in the oven.
- Once it is in the oven turn the heat down to 160 degrees. Cook for around 1 hour and a half, making sure that there’s water, not too much, just a little so the meat doesn’t dry.
- When it is cooked, the pork meat should just fall apart easily. Pull the pork with forks.
- To serve, heat the tortillas, chop the veggies, prepare the tomatillo salsa.
- Serve the carnitas in tacos, add some veggies, spicy salsa and enjoy!
